Database as a Service (DBaaS)
With DBaaS, businesses can manage their databases without handling the underlying infrastructure. It offers scalability, reliability, and user-friendly interfaces, making it efficient for IT teams. DBaaS solutions streamline database management by minimizing administrative tasks. They empower organizations to swiftly scale operations and enhance their performance.
